Full Job Description

First Response Service (FRS) is expanding to include Mental health Response Vehicles (MHRV) across the Trust footprint. The post provides an opportunity for motivated individuals to be involved in developing the FRS delivery model. The MHRV's attend specific mental health jobs where a double-crewed ambulance and transport to AED's may not be required as there is no physical injury. Patients will be transported to safe spaces across the Trust including crisis cafes, where the team will have access to First Responders. The post holder will be expected to work as part of the Urgent Care Mental Health First Response Service which includes Crisis Resolution Home Treatment Teams, Liaison Services, Street Triage Services, Liaison and Diversion Services.

Cheshire and Wirral Partnership (CWP) provides health and care services for a population of over one million people, including mental health, learning disability, community physical health and all-age disability care, as well as the provision of three GP surgeries in Cheshire. We employ around 4,500 staff across 73 sites and have services across Wirral and Cheshire, as well as Trafford, Warrington, Bolton, Halton and Liverpool. We also provide specialist services for the North West as a whole. Our aim is to help improve the lives of everyone in our communities, adopting a compassionate, person-centred approach to everything we do. We are rated as Outstanding for Caring by the Care Quality Commission, with a Good rating overall. An exciting opportunity has arisen within our First Response Service. The successful applicant will be providing enhanced management and mental health assessment for individuals who contact 999 with mental health crisis via the Mental Health Response Vehicle (MHRV). MHRV will be based at Bebington and Northwich Ambulance stations.
